Nautical weekend in sight
18th July 2004 15.53pm
 
July 25th promises to be a day to remember in the local boating calendar, as craft of all shapes and sizes assemble on the Kennet and Avon Canal adjacent to Newbury's Victoria Park.

As well as the boats, there will be a line dancing display, folk music and other entertainment including children's fairground rides, children's train rides and a pony and trap. The motor barge Avon will be giving one hour trips throughout the day.

For the more adventurous visitor, you will have the opportunity to try canoeing. Not forgetting the popular duck race and the children's treasure trail. There will be a barbecue selling burgers, hot dogs and cold drinks.
